Correct answer: A). Soil

The plants obtain nitrogen by the process of absorption from the soil or from the roots in the form of nitrite ions, ammonium or nitrate ions. Plants do not obtain nitrogen from the air, rather it is broken down into nitrogen molecules by the process of nitrogen fixation. The nitrogen-fixing bacteria and archaea live in root nodules of the plant that fix nitrogen in the soil and they have can convert molecular nitrogen from the air into ammonia.

Hence, the correct answer would be option A.
